At Bastion, we are building the regulated financial infrastructure that powers modern businesses. Our comprehensive product suite enables stablecoin issuance, custodial wallet management, and global asset conversion. By combining a compliance-first approach with robust risk management, we ensure the security and integrity of all financial activity within our systems. Whether we are operating under our own licenses or providing support for our customers, we are dedicated to creating reliable, high-integrity financial rails.
The role
We are seeking a Senior Infrastructure Engineer to join our team on a full-time basis. This is a senior-level position that requires a high degree of autonomy and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ced startup environment. You can work remotely from anywhere in the United States, or join us at our office in New York City.
Core responsibilities
- Take full ownership of critical infrastructure domains, such as our Kubernetes platform, observability stack, or CI/CD pipelines, to enhance system reliability and developer velocity.
- Design and implement scalable infrastructure-as-code solutions using Terraform to standardize deployment patterns across development, sandbox, and production environments.
- Collaborate closely with our engineering, security, and compliance teams to balance technical tradeoffs, optimize costs, and harden our AWS environment against security threats.
Skills and experience
To be successful in this role, you should have extensive experience with our core technology stack and a proven track record of managing complex cloud environments. We look for proficiency in the following areas:
- Cloud and Compute: Deep expertise in AWS, including EKS, ECS, Lambda, and EC2, alongside strong skills in Kubernetes and Docker.
- Infrastructure-as-Code: Advanced proficiency in Terraform for managing and automating infrastructure.
- Programming: Experience writing production-grade code in Go and TypeScript.
- Data and Observability: Familiarity with Postgres, Redis, and Kafka, as well as experience with monitoring tools like Datadog, Grafana, and Sentry.
- Operational Excellence: A history of improving CI/CD reliability, implementing security best practices, and managing incident response.
